I also have a quick tip/idea on what to do with old Christmas cards. I don't like to throw them away, especially the photo cards. Someone went through the time and effort to send them out so I like to keep them. But what do you do with them?? Well, here's my solution:

I bound them all with a big ring like a Christmas book. Now, I didn't put every single Christmas card in there. Mostly the photos, photo cards, letters & a few cute Christmas cards that I really liked. For every year I put a title page to keep that year's photos together. I also marked the year on the back of each in case they ever got mixed up.

And that's it! Now we have a fun holiday book that we can look through year after year. I'll have another idea of what to do with your leftover Christmas cards on my blog tomorrow :) Happy Christmas week everyone!!
